There are many reasons why you should keep up with regular auto maintenance. For starters, regular auto maintenance can keep a larger problem from occurring, catching and repairing smaller issues before they can turn into bigger ones. It will also save you money, keeping you from a complex repair; plus, well-maintained vehicles have better fuel efficiency. The least well-known reason to upkeep your vehicle is the resale value. If you can show maintenance records when you decide it’s time to upgrade, you can preserve the value of your vehicle. Knowing all of this, why wouldn’t you want to maintain it?
